Transaction accdf21bcde4ee810b8b20b40bf4c623664ff4ea06d12c27f1e35f71ef3ebb85

7 Input
2 Outputs
  • accdf21bcde4ee810b8b20b40bf4c623664ff4ea06d12c27f1e35f71ef3ebb85:0
  • value  1578461
    address  15HXKJ9T5c3ryXaRrFvAavSwtWgLcHrQqH
  • accdf21bcde4ee810b8b20b40bf4c623664ff4ea06d12c27f1e35f71ef3ebb85:1
  • value  96858000
    address  1ExgKspW8TxVMTcdd4friNCpw7tSiR1BVW